The Texas Leadership Scholars (TLS) program seeks top performing students with demonstrated
financial need, leadership in their high school community, and academic success.
- Demonstrated financial need, as evidenced by FAFSA or TASFA (must be TEXAS Grant eligible). The FAFSA/TASFA must be completed by the application deadline, February 19, 2026.
- Graduating High School Senior during the current application cycle from an accredited
Texas High School.
- Scholastic record and ability through top 10% or submit a recommendation letter from
a high school staff member.
- Evidence of leadership and service within your high school and community.
- Accepted to a participating 4-year institution.
- Complete Application Process and receive a recommendation from a principal, teacher,
counselor, coach, etc. from their graduating high school.
Once scholars are admitted to the program, they must maintain TEXAS Grant eligibility,
full-time enrollment, maintain a minimum GPA of 2.5, meet Satisfactory Academic Progress,
and complete all program requirements.
Each participating university has a designated TLS Campus Coordinator as the scholars’
primary point of contact and a mentor. Programming will be conducted or organized
by this person, who will also regularly meet with the scholars as a group and in 1:1
meetings.
A Living Learning Community (LLC) is a component of this program. This may require
scholars to live on campus in a specific community with other TLS recipients for the
first 2 years of the program. Questions regarding this requirement should be directed
to specific institution.
The Application Process
Applications Open for the Fall 2026 Cohort 5 - November 1, 2025
Students must received the application from a staff member (guidance counselor, teacher,
principal, etc.) at their graduating high school. High School staff members can learn more about the program or request the application
by visiting the High School Staff Resources page.
In the application, students should be prepared to:
- Provide basic information about themselves, including their current high school GPA.
- Self-assess their leadership skills.
- Provide short responses explaining how they have been a leader in their community.
- Rank three potential participating schools to which they've applied.
- Provide the contact information of someone from their graduating high school who can
serve as a reference. A recommendation form will automatically be sent to them upon
submission.
- All recommendations must be received by February 19, 2026 at 11:59 pm CST. We strongly
urge completing the application by mid-January to ensure time for the recommendation
to be submitted before applications are reviewed by Texas Leadership Scholars Program
staff.
*At the onset of awarding, the Scholarship is not transferable because we seek to
ensure a cohort of students at each campus. If the student does not attend the institution
which awarded the scholarship, they will be foregoing being a participant in this
program.*
